This is the mail archive of the gcc@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]

Re: Ada (Was: GCC 3.0 Release Criteria)



>     It would be wise to discuss the integrations issues on this list since
>     ultimately this group is going to be affected by those changes and may
>     have opinions/ideas on how to make it go more smoothly.

Richard Kenner writes:
> Sorry for the confusion.  The issues aren't techincal at all: all
> needed GCC changes have already been checked in.  I'm talking about
> the issues raised by the *size* of GNAT's sources and how to
> coordinate it with the GNAT/Linux project's tree.

If GNAT works without any patches to other gcc sources when 3.0 is
released, then it doesn't seem that there is anything else left to be done
(I hadn't realized that Kenner had made so much progress on integration
with the current GCC tree).  Given GNAT's large size and the smaller
number of interested people (compared to C and C++), and the fact that the
bootstrap process cannot build it (the front end is written in Ada so you
need an Ada compiler such as an earlier version of GNAT to build it) I
don't think it's really that desirable to physically put the GNAT source
into the GCC tree.

Rather, it would suffice to include pointers on the gcc web site and
documentation to the corresponding information for GNAT, so that
interested people could load it.



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]